pandas新增一列并按條件賦值 VBA中,把一列數(shù)據(jù)賦值給數(shù)組,代碼怎么寫的?
VBA中,把一列數(shù)據(jù)賦值給數(shù)組,代碼怎么寫的?Dim lie=列(1)1可以更改為所需的列,例如2、3、4、5。Lie是這個變量保存的數(shù)組。這是單個活動表第一列的數(shù)據(jù)如何給datatable的某一列賦
VBA中,把一列數(shù)據(jù)賦值給數(shù)組,代碼怎么寫的?
Dim lie=列(1)1可以更改為所需的列,例如2、3、4、5。Lie是這個變量保存的數(shù)組。這是單個活動表第一列的數(shù)據(jù)
如何給datatable的某一列賦值?
dataframe需要添加一個新列,只需使用最簡單的賦值語句將數(shù)據(jù)賦給不存在的列即可。如果DF是您的數(shù)據(jù)幀,則有兩列“col1”和“col2”,如下所示:
DF[“new”]=DF[“col1”]DF[“col2”
Python怎么將DataFrame數(shù)據(jù)類型增加新的兩列并賦值?
可以對列進行操作,只需使用apply方法即可。具體分析如下:前提:加載numpy,pandas和series,dataframe,生成一個3乘3的dataframe,命名frame,使用frame的第二列生成series,命名series 1。此外,框架.添加(series1,axis=0)。減法:sub分別嘗試不填充和填充以比較效果。乘法,幀.mul(系列1,軸=0),除法,框架.div(series1,axis=0)。這里的序列是由dataframe的一列生成的,因此不存在找不到索引的情況。如果找不到索引,則生成并集,缺少的值為Nan。四個算術(shù)運算的括號中有一個參數(shù)axis=0,表示索引按行匹配并在列上廣播。發(fā)展:Python是目前最流行、最簡單、應(yīng)用最廣泛的編程語言,應(yīng)該在大數(shù)據(jù)時代學(xué)習(xí)。其中,pandas是Python中最經(jīng)典的庫之一。
python中,dataframe或series對象可以對列進行運算么(加減乘除)?比如某一列全部“ 1”?
運行環(huán)境:python3.6
導(dǎo)入panda作為PD
D1=[“銅版紙”、“300g”、“[啞膜
]D2=[“銅版紙”、“300g”、“[5
]D3=[“銅版紙”、“300g”、“[啞膜
!D4=[“銅版紙”、“300g”、“[1
數(shù)據(jù)=pd.數(shù)據(jù)幀(數(shù)據(jù)=[D1,D2,D3,D4,],columns=[“paper”,首先,我們創(chuàng)建一個dataframe,其中包含以下數(shù)據(jù):如果我們要過濾D列數(shù)據(jù)中大于0的行,&符號可以用來過濾多個條件。當(dāng)然,“|”符號也可以用來過濾多個條件,除非它是或。假設(shè)我們只需要A列和B列數(shù)據(jù),D列和C列數(shù)據(jù)用于過濾